top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

    深入探索区块链:掌握未来数字经济的核心课程

    • 2026-02-13 20:01:45

                一、区块链的基础知识

                区块链技术作为一种颠覆性的技术,近年来受到了全球范围内的广泛关注。它是一种分布式账本技术,通过加密手段确保数据的安全与不可篡改。区块链的核心特征在于去中心化,使得用户能够在没有中介的情况下进行交易和信息共享。

                在学习区块链课程时,首先需要掌握基本概念和术语。例如,了解区块、链、节点、共识机制等基本构件。区块是存储数据的容器,而链则是由多个区块按时间顺序连接而成的。节点是网络中的计算机,参与数据验证与交易记录。共识机制则是区块链网络中用于达成一致的协议,常见的有工作量证明(PoW)和权益证明(PoS)。

                二、区块链课程的内容大纲

                区块链的课程通常包括以下几个方面的内容:

                • 区块链的历史与发展:回顾区块链技术的起源,从比特币的诞生讲起,了解其背后的技术理念和社会影响。
                • 技术架构与工作原理:深入分析区块链的工作原理,学习其技术架构,包括节点的角色、交易的生成与传播、验证机制等。
                • 智能合约:学习智能合约的定义、工作方式及其在区块链中的应用,如何通过合约实现自动化和去中心化的业务逻辑。
                • 数字货币与资产:探讨区块链在数字货币、代币发行(ICO)、去中心化金融(DeFi)等方面的应用,以及相关的经济模式。
                • 区块链的安全性与隐私保护:讨论区块链技术所面临的安全挑战,包括51%攻击、双花攻击等,以及如何通过加密技术和隐私保护方案来增强安全性。
                • 区块链的法律与监管:研究各国对区块链和数字货币的法律框架与政策,了解合规的必要性。
                • 区块链的未来趋势:分析区块链技术的发展前景,探讨其在各行各业的潜在应用,特别是在供应链管理、医疗、金融、房地产等领域。

                三、学习区块链的途径

                对于想要学习区块链的人来说,选择合适的学习途径至关重要。以下是几种建议的方法:

                • 在线课程:许多知名的在线学习平台如Coursera、edX和Udacity都提供区块链相关的课程,适合不同层次的学习者。
                • 参加线下培训班:许多教育机构和行业组织也会举办区块链相关的培训班和研讨会,能提供面对面的学习体验和行业交流机会。
                • 阅读相关书籍与文献:可以通过专业书籍、学术论文、白皮书等,提高对区块链的深入理解。
                • 加入社区与论坛:积极参与区块链相关的在线社区、论坛等,获取最新的信息,以及与他人交流学习心得。

                四、常见的相关问题

                区块链的应用场景有哪些?

                区块链的应用场景广泛,涵盖了多个行业和领域。以下是一些典型的应用场景:

                • 金融行业:区块链可以用于跨境支付、清算与结算等,降低交易成本,提升效率。同时,去中心化金融(DeFi)的兴起,让用户能够直接进行借贷、交易等金融活动,无需中介。
                • 供应链管理:通过区块链技术,供应链上的每一个环节都可以实时记录和共享信息,保证数据的透明性,降低欺诈风险,提升整体效率。
                • 医疗健康:区块链可用于患者的健康记录管理,使得医疗数据更加安全,加速医疗数据的共享和流通。
                • 版权保护:艺术作品、音乐、视频等的著作权可以通过区块链技术进行保护,确保创作者的权益不被侵犯。
                • 电子选票与投票系统:利用区块链技术提升选举的透明度与安全性,防止选举舞弊。

                区块链与传统数据库的区别是什么?

                区块链与传统的数据库系统相比,具有如下几个显著的区别:

                • 数据存储方式:传统数据库通常采用中心化存储,由单一的管理系统进行控制。而区块链则是去中心化的,每个参与节点都有一份完整的数据副本,采用多方共同维护的数据结构。
                • 数据的不可篡改性:区块链数据一旦写入后,相较于传统数据库,几乎不可以被篡改和删除,确保了数据的公正性和可信度。
                • 透明性与信任:在区块链网络中,所有参与者可以查看数据,而传统数据库则常常是封闭的,只有授权的用户才能存取和修改数据。
                • 智能合约:区块链可以实现程序化的智能合约,定义交易的条件与逻辑,自动执行合约内容,而传统数据库则不具备此能力。

                如何保障区块链的安全性?

                区块链的安全性是确保系统稳定运行的关键,保障措施主要包括:

                • 密码学方法:利用哈希算法、非对称加密等密码学技术确保数据的安全性和隐私性,防止未经授权的访问和数据泄露。
                • 共识机制:选择合适的共识机制是保障区块链安全性的重要环节。工作量证明(PoW)、权益证明(PoS)等共识算法保障了网络中的节点之间达成一致和信任。
                • 分布式存储:分布式的数据存储大大增强了数据的安全性,使得单点故障的风险下降,降低了被攻击的可能性。

                区块链面临的主要挑战是什么?

                尽管区块链具有诸多优势,但也面临着一些挑战:

                • 可扩展性区块链的交易处理速度与吞吐量有限,目前在高流量的情况下可能无法有效处理大量的交易,影响了其应用的广泛性。
                • 法律与政策风险:区块链技术的快速发展尚未得到相应的法律框架约束,可能面临监管不完善带来的风险,进而影响其发展进程。
                • 用户教育:许多用户对区块链技术的理解仍较为肤浅,需要更多的教育与推广。
                通过以上的详细阐述,希望读者对区块链课程有更深入的了解,不仅掌握理论知识,还能了解其实际应用及面临的挑战。随着区块链科技的不断发展,学习这一领域的课程是把握未来数字经济的重要一步。
                • Tags
                • 区块链,数字货币,去中心化